SQL Practice – Questions & Answers
Beginner Level
Q16. COUNT function.
SELECT COUNT(*) FROM students;
Q17. MAX value.
SELECT MAX(marks) FROM students;
Q18. MIN value.
SELECT MIN(marks) FROM students;
Q19. AVG value.
SELECT AVG(marks) FROM students;
Q20. LIKE operator.
SELECT * FROM students WHERE name LIKE 'A%';
Intermediate Level
Q21. BETWEEN.
SELECT * FROM students WHERE age BETWEEN 18 AND 25;
Q22. IN operator.
SELECT * FROM students WHERE city IN('Delhi','Mumbai');Q23. LIMIT.
SELECT * FROM students LIMIT 5;
Q24. Alias.
SELECT name AS student_name FROM students;
Q25. ALTER add column.
ALTER TABLE students ADD city VARCHAR(20);
Advanced Level
Q26. PRIMARY KEY.
id INT PRIMARY KEY
Q27. FOREIGN KEY.
FOREIGN KEY(sid) REFERENCES students(id);
Q28. UNIQUE constraint.
email VARCHAR(50) UNIQUE
Q29. INDEX.
CREATE INDEX idx_name ON students(name);
Q30. CASE statement.
CASE WHEN age>18 THEN 'Adult' ELSE 'Minor' END
No comments:
Post a Comment